Biochemical Fulvic Acid 95% Powder (Plant-Derived)

Corn Stalk Source Biochemical Fulvic Acid

NovaFul is a plant-derived biochemical fulvic acid 95% powder extracted from corn stalks by biological fermentation. It works as a natural chelating agent, soil conditioner and stress tolerance booster, improving nutrient uptake, soil structure and fertilizer efficiency while stimulating root development and resilience to drought and salinity. For field use: foliar spray 150–300 g/ha (dilute 1:3,000–1:5,000 in water, approx. 20–30 g per 100 L) every 10–14 days; fertigation 1.0–3.0 kg/ha per application (3–4 times per crop cycle); seed soaking at 1:800–1:1,000 for 8–12 hours. For formulators: add 5–15% (w/v) into liquid biostimulant concentrates or 2–10% (w/w) into water-soluble NPK and micronutrient blends. Packed in 25 kg bags with custom OEM packaging. Alginate Oligosaccharides (AOS) 90% Powder | Seaweed Elicitor Biostimulant

Marine Oligomer Derived from Irish Atlantic Ascophyllum Nodosum

Alginate Oligosaccharides (AOS) 90% Powder is an ultra-pure marine biostimulant derived from natural brown seaweed via advanced enzymatic hydrolysis, with a strictly controlled degree of polymerization (DP 2-10) and ultra-low molecular weight (≤1,500 Da). As a powerful elicitor and signaling molecule, it penetrates plant tissues rapidly to stimulate explosive root development, trigger stress-resistance gene expression against drought, frost and salinity, and boost fruit coloring and sugar accumulation. For field use: foliar spray 30–60 g of AOS 90% powder per hectare (≈27–54 g a.i./ha; working solution 30–60 ppm at approx. 1,000 L/ha, i.e., 3–6 g per 100 L water) at critical stages or 2–3 days before expected stress; drip irrigation 100–300 g/ha. For formulators: add 0.1–0.5% (1–5 kg per metric ton) into liquid fertilizers, seaweed extracts or amino acid solutions. Packed in 20 kg bags with custom OEM packaging. Chitosan Oligosaccharide 90% Powder (COS / Enzymatic Oligochitosan)

Marine Biostimulant Derived from Alaskan Snow Crab Shells

Chitosan Oligosaccharides (COS) 90% Powder is a marine-sourced biopolymer elicitor biostimulant extracted from Alaskan snow crab shells for foliar spray, fertigation, and liquid fertilizer formulations. It activates the plant's systemic acquired resistance (SAR) against fungal and bacterial pathogens, suppresses root-knot nematodes and soil-borne diseases, and improves root development under drought, salinity and temperature stress. For field use: foliar spray dilute 1:3,000–1:5,000 (≈20–33 g per 100 L water), repeat every 10–15 days, 2–3 applications per cycle; fertigation and drip irrigation 750–1,500 g/ha. As a liquid formula additive: add 0.5–1.0% w/w into amino acid, seaweed, or micronutrient blends. Packed in 20 kg bags with custom OEM packaging.
